Overview of the French Bulldog
The French Bulldog came from England Franz Bulldoggen welpen in the 19th century and was later established in France. Initially bred as a smaller version of the English Bulldog, they were mainly utilized for ratting and as companions for lace workers. Today, French Bulldogs are mainly known for their caring nature and captivating personalities. The breed is little, normally weighing in between 16 to 28 pounds and standing about 11 to 12 inches high.

Comprehending the temperament characteristics of French Bulldogs can help possible owners assess whether this type is an excellent fit for their lifestyle. Overall, French Bulldogs tend to display the following characteristics:
1. Affectionate Nature
French Bulldogs are understood for being exceptionally caring. They form strong bonds with their owners and delight in physical nearness. This type thrives on companionship and often shows desire for attention, making them exceptional buddy pet dogs.
2. Playfulness
In spite of their calm behavior, French Bulldogs have a spirited spirit. They delight in interactive video games and playtime, both indoors and outdoors. This particular makes them particularly attracting households or individuals looking for an appealing pet.
3. Social and Friendly
French Bulldogs generally hit it off with both individuals and other animals. Their friendly personality makes them outstanding prospects for homes with kids and other pets. They are not understood to be aggressive, which contributes to their track record as family-friendly pets.
